WebApr 10, 2024 · Making this easy chicken cobbler recipe into a freezer meal is simple! Follow the steps below and you can store this recipe in the freezer for up to 6 months. Assemble the casserole through step 4 in a freezer safe casserole dish. Freeze. When ready to cook, thaw in the fridge for 24-48 hours. Bake as directed.
